Key Features to Look for in Modern Roaming Testing Solutions

-

Roaming testing solutions are crucial tools in today’s quickly changing mobile ecosystem to guarantee flawless connectivity and an excellent user experience across networks globally. Selecting the best testing solution is essential for operators looking to maximise performance and minimise revenue loss as roaming situations get more complicated, particularly with the introduction of 5G, IoT devices, and various network types. When choosing a contemporary roaming testing solution, keep the following aspects in mind.

All-inclusive Protocol Assistance

Numerous signalling protocols, including SS7, Diameter, SIP, and the recently released 5G signalling standards, are used in modern roaming. This broad range must be supported by a reliable testing solution in order to precisely simulate, examine, and validate roaming behaviours across both legacy and next-generation networks.

Capabilities for End-to-End Testing

All facets of the roaming process, from initial attach, authentication, and registration to service continuity, handovers, and payment triggers, should be covered by the solution’s end-to-end testing capabilities. This guarantees that each phase of the roaming user journey is validated in authentic settings.

Analytics and Real-Time Monitoring

Advanced analytics and real-time monitoring dashboards are offered by efficient roaming testing solutions. This feature speeds up troubleshooting and decision-making by enabling operators to promptly detect abnormalities, protocol violations, or performance bottlenecks.

Scalability and Automation

Manual testing is no longer practical due to roaming traffic’s complexity and volume. High-volume, repeatable testing is made possible by automation features including test scripting, scheduling, and batch execution. Scalability ensures that the system can handle growing network sizes and roaming partners.

Assistance with M2M and IoT Roaming

A contemporary roaming testing tool has to manage the distinct traffic patterns and authentication methods typical of IoT and machine-to-machine (M2M) interactions, which have increased dramatically in recent years. This guarantees smooth roaming, even for devices with sporadic or low-power connectivity.

Testing for Fraud and Revenue Assurance

Fraud attempts and billing problems are common in roaming contexts. Leading solutions assist operators in protecting their revenue and upholding consumer confidence by integrating revenue assurance validation and fraud detection scenarios.

Support for Multiple Operators and Interoperability

Interoperability testing across various operators and network configurations should be supported by the tool. In order to confirm interoperability and guarantee seamless inter-operator connection, this involves mimicking the hardware and setups of several roaming partners.

Flexible and Cloud-Native Deployment

Cloud-native architectures that allow deployment flexibility, whether on-premises, in private clouds, or through hybrid models, should be a feature of contemporary roaming testing solutions. Operators may save infrastructure costs, expand testing resources flexibly, and swiftly update testing environments as networks change thanks to this flexibility. Additionally, cloud-native solutions speed up issue resolution and the time-to-market for new roaming services by facilitating cooperation across teams and geographical boundaries.

Conclusion

Selecting the best roaming testing solution is a calculated move that has an immediate effect on revenue protection, customer happiness, and network dependability. Comprehensive protocol coverage, end-to-end testing, real-time analytics, automation, and support for new use cases like fraud detection and IoT roaming are all essential components of modern systems. In an increasingly complicated mobile ecosystem, operators can enable smooth, secure worldwide connection and confidently confirm roaming performance by concentrating on these essential elements.
